2. High-Frequency PCB & High-Density Interconnect (HDI) Standards

As operating frequencies increase for industrial communication, signal loss becomes a primary design constraint. In the Korean automotive radar and cellular base station sectors, multi-layer circuit boards must feature precise layer registration, low dielectric dissipation factor (Df), and controlled dielectric constant (Dk). Utilizing specialized materials such as Taconic TLY-5 (0.254mm) allows manufacturers to limit signal degradation. Furthermore, multi-layer designs (typically 4 to 18 layers for mainstream industrial computing) rely on microvias and advanced resin-filling processes to optimize routing space without sacrificing board integrity or signal stability.

3. Industrial Applications & Embedded Memory Synchronization

Modern automated machinery in Korea, including high-power inverter welding systems (e.g., ZX7-200/250 series) and server motherboards, requires seamless integration between the processing logic board and volatile memory. Industry-grade ECC (Error-Correcting Code) DDR4 and DDR5 memory modules act as the buffer for critical automation controls. The synchronization between high-speed memory modules and multilayer host PCBs is crucial. The layout geometry must minimize crosstalk, manage power distribution network (PDN) impedance, and offer robust heat dissipation through custom heatsinks and heat spreaders (such as dual-fan configurations or integrated copper cooling blocks).

4. Supply Chain Sourcing: China to South Korea Logistics and Compliance

Procuring multi-layer circuit boards and memory units from China offers significant cost and scale benefits, provided that the manufacturer complies with South Korean standards. Essential compliance points include:

  • KC Certification (Korea Certification): Required for electronics entering the Korean market to ensure electromagnetic compatibility (EMC) and electrical safety.
  • RoHS & REACH Compliance: Minimizing hazardous substances in the PCB surface finishing (e.g., Lead-Free HASL, ENIG, OSP) to align with South Korea's strict environmental laws.
  • Sino-Korean FTA Tariff Optimization: Proper documentation of Certificate of Origin (Form K) allows Korean importers to leverage preferential tariff rates, significantly reducing total landing costs.

Technical Stackup & Materials Matrix

When selecting multilayer PCBs, engineers must align the physical layers with performance needs. Standard stackups vary from simple 4-layer power distribution boards to high-density 16+ layer backplanes. Below are key parameters utilized during the engineering phase:

  • Base Materials: High-Tg FR-4 (Tg170, Tg180), Halogen-free laminates, Taconic series, and metal-core substrates for thermal applications.
  • Copper Cladding: Thicknesses ranging from 0.5oz (18µm) for dense signal lines up to 3oz (105µm) for power-heavy inverter boards.
  • Surface Treatments: ENIG (Electroless Nickel Immersion Gold) for fine-pitch components, Lead-Free HASL (Hot Air Solder Leveling) for reliable cost-efficiency, and OSP (Organic Sphericity Preservative).
  • Minimum Line/Space Width: Capable of resolving down to 3mil/3mil (75µm/75µm) on HDI structures to accommodate BGA pitches.

Q3: Can we custom-specify high-frequency substrate layers (e.g., Taconic or Rogers) within a multi-layer board stackup?
A3: Yes. We support hybrid stackups that combine standard FR-4 (such as Shengyi or Nanya) with high-frequency laminates like Taconic TLY-5 or Rogers RO4350B. This hybrid construction provides high performance for high-frequency signal layers while reducing overall manufacturing costs.
